Social Inequality Project
Silk Screened Transparencies
This project was to describe the barriers created with inequality in society and portray the restrictions placed on people that are on the lower end of the inequality in a society. As an installation piece located in Graffiti Alley in Ann Arbor, MI and on the web, the concept was to produce silkscreened images that is laid over a space where this initial interac¬tive narrative is launched, depicting the poverty line, limitations of poverty and the human condition in poverty. 
"Someone needs to make an impact."
Underneath were tear off tags that promoted the blog we desinged and asked people to make a choice or make an impact.
